SafeOperation

Gem Version Build Status

Write safer code with SafeOperation.

Installation

Add this line to your application's Gemfile:

gem "safe_operation"

And then execute:

$ bundle

Or install it yourself as:

$ gem install safe_operation

Usage

No monkey patch.

class RecordNotFound < StandardError; end
class User def self.find(id); new; end; end;
class Guest; end
class Admin; def initialize(user); end; end
class SuperAdmin; def initialize(admin); end; end

operation = SafeOperation.run do
  User.find(1)
end

# Know if operation succeeded
operation.success?

# Get the value of the performed operation
operation.value

# Common patterns, reloaded
SafeOperation.run { User.find(1) }.value_or(Guest.new)

# Handling exceptions
SafeOperation.run { raise(RecordNotFound) }.value_or_else do |exception|
  if exception.is_a?(RecordNotFound)
    Guest.new
  else
    # logging, re-raise, etc.
  end
end

# Apply on first operation
operation = SafeOperation.
  run { User.find(1) }.
  and_then { |user| Admin.new(user) }

operation.value # #<Admin ...>

# Chainable
operation = SafeOperation.
  run { User.find(1) }.
  and_then { |user| Admin.new(user) }.
  and_then { |admin| SuperAdmin.new(admin) }

operation.value # #<SuperAdmin ...>

# Add or_else to handle failed operation
operation = SafeOperation.
  run { raise(RecordNotFound) }.
  and_then { |user| Admin.new(user) }.
  or_else { Guest.new }

operation.success? # => false
operation.value # => #<Guest ...>
